Output 1d66c33fcf901efba9ab0327fbe0e4de1446230f8c98d8c3edb80a909f60e84d:17

value
9953334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7229d77dcd2ecba322ec30be9075d7a5cce5f1 OP_EQUAL
address
37CdEGYMCsKbbiqQUTWwGwgtjfepiWEAPs
transaction
1d66c33fcf901efba9ab0327fbe0e4de1446230f8c98d8c3edb80a909f60e84d
spent
true